CASE STUDY:
OPERATIONAL CHALLENGE
The locations of the cooling towers for water treatment at the universities made liquid chemical delivery in pails and drums difficult, time consuming and potentially hazardous.
CHEMICAL SOLUTION
Kroff Chemical Company, Inc. proposed a change in the way the universities deliver chemicals for water treatment by switching to solid feeder technology.The new system allows for solid chemicals to be diluted on site and metered into the cooling water according to the technical requirements.
The system engineered by Kroff Chemical Company, Inc. improves safety, reduces freight costs, decreases chemical distribution time and costs, and improves the technical reliability of chemical feeds.
BOTTOM-LINE RESULTS
Kroff Chemical Company’s implementation of a solid feeder system is saving approximately 14.6 percent per year in operational costs and significantly reducing the need for employees to handle hazardous chemical containers at each of the cooling tower locations at the universities.
